    Hawking, like all humans, has made some mistakes in his profession - most notably the long standing paradox regarding information getting lost versus getting mangled within black holes. He was vehemently opposed to many other physicists about the nature of Black Holes, undertook a famous bet with an American physicist, and ultimately after many years Hawking finally conceded that he was wrong and completely reversed his position.

    So, like the rest of humanity, Hawking is fallable.
